Output faf64ab0bf3087025dfbb20e9d818cd9a0c17f61ed0aaee651c05ca35573bd9e:0

value
49799818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50d777068340553430e466c882d949fb3d0a12c OP_EQUAL
address
3KewB1NhEXjswXKzxaPsLSrNLY1ZPhihHy
transaction
faf64ab0bf3087025dfbb20e9d818cd9a0c17f61ed0aaee651c05ca35573bd9e
spent
true